Contemporary Elegance Meets Natural Wonder

Positioned in Canberra's premier eco-friendly master-planned community, 11 Max Day Lane, Macnamara, offers a brand-new architectural sanctuary where modern luxury effortlessly blends with sustainable design. Bordered by the breathtaking Ginninderry Conservation Corridor and showcasing vistas toward the Brindabella Mountains, this newly constructed four-bedroom, three-bathroom home is engineered for premium comfort, high functionality, and flawless modern living.
From the moment you step inside, the home commands attention with soaring 3.6m high ceilings and premium hybrid flooring that flows seamlessly across a brilliant architectural layout. Designed to maximize natural light and daily functionality, the home begins with a separate lounge room at the front-offering a quiet, private retreat perfect for formal entertaining, a home office, or a peaceful media space.
The heart of the home opens up into an expansive, sun-drenched open-plan living and dining area. Designed for effortless transitions between relaxed family time and upscale hosting, this space pivots around a high-end culinary kitchen. Crafted with premium functionality in mind, the kitchen features striking stone benchtops, a large breakfast bar for casual morning gatherings, and a walk-in pantry. A suite of high-performance Fisher & Paykel appliances-including a 900mm induction cooktop, a built-in oven, and a dishwasher-ensures a superior cooking experience.
The bedroom layout has been meticulously planned to offer optimal privacy for growing families, multi-generational households, or those who love hosting overnight visitors. The master suite serves as a sophisticated, light-filled haven, complete with a large walk-in robe and a beautifully appointed private ensuite. On the opposite side, a dedicated guest bedroom acts as a second suite, offering its own spacious built-in robes and private ensuite access. Two additional generously sized bedrooms feature built-in robes and are serviced by a large, pristine main bathroom configured with a deep bathtub, a separate shower, and an independent toilet room for maximum morning convenience.
Step through the expansive double-glazed windows to discover an expansive outdoor entertaining area, perfectly adapted for weekend barbecues and alfresco dining. The front and backyards have been carefully levelled to provide an attractive, low-maintenance landscape. Framed securely by a courtyard wall, the perimeter offers exceptional privacy and a safe, effortless environment for children and pets to play without demanding your entire weekend to maintain.
Built to align with Macnamara's world-class environmental benchmarks, the home is equipped with zoned ducted reverse cycle heating and cooling for personalized climate control across different rooms. Double-glazed windows fitted with quality window coverings work in tandem with the thermal design to dramatically optimize energy efficiency, keeping your home perfectly insulated through Canberra's crisp winters and warm summers. Complete with a secure double garage, this turnkey residence represents a flawless opportunity to move straight into a highly sought-after, future-proof pocket of the ACT.
As part of the visionary Ginninderry region-Canberra's only 6-Star Green Star community-Macnamara is a highly progressive suburb designed for outdoor adventure, ecological sustainability, and strong neighborhood connection. Residents here enjoy an enviable lifestyle surrounded by parklands, community gardens, cycle paths, and the iconic Ginninderry Conservation Corridor, which features over 14 kilometers of walking trails, picnic areas, and Canberra's unique swing bridges. While immersed in nature, you remain remarkably connected. The home offers easy walking access to public transport networks, is a short distance from the popular Paddy's Park, and puts you within easy reach of local childcare options and schools. Situated just 8 minutes from Kippax Fair, 12 minutes from the Belconnen Town Centre, and an easy 19-minute commute to the Civic CBD, 11 Max Day Lane provides a rare opportunity to secure a premium, sophisticated home in a spectacular location.
